2018 athlete Tre' Turner: Two sports, one special talent
Posted Jun 28, 2016
Tre' Turner loves sports. He lives them, breathes them and even eats them when he isn't hitting up his family’s restaurant, Boss Hog’s Bar-B-Que. Turner’s first infatuation was basketball, following his brother and 2014 NBA first-round draft pick P.J. Hairston on the AAU circuit when he was just a month old. Though that fire is still burning strong 16 years later, another has kindled: football.
